Mark your calendars! The first-ever National Robotics Week takes place April 10 – 18 and it’s not something you want to miss!
The goal of National Robotics Week is to educate and excite the general public about the current and future impact of robotics. A host of museums, organizations, and businesses are celebrating with robot-related events, open houses, and competitions. The oldest robotics competition, the National Robotics Challenge (NRC), is one of the events being held during this week. The NRC takes place April 15 – 17 in Marion, Ohio, just down the street from the Robots.com facility.
National Robotics Week was created by an Advisory Council made up of prominent companies, educational institutions, and organizations, including iRobot Corp, Adept Technologies, FIRST, MIT, RIA, and many others.
